摘要
为了解土壤中多环芳烃的污染状况,本研究分别采集了我国背景区域、农村区域和城市区域的表层土壤,用气相色谱-质谱联用仪测定16种PAHs,分析不同区域土壤中多环芳烃的含量、污染特征及生态风险。结果表明,背景区域中各PAHs单体检出较少或含量很低,几乎未受多环芳烃污染。城市区域由于受工业企业生产活动、交通运输、废水废气及固体废弃物排放等因素影响,土壤中PAHs含量较高,污染严重,7种致癌多环芳烃占比高,毒性当量浓度大,致癌风险高。农村区域土壤中多环芳烃为轻微污染,污染风险低。
In order to understand the pollution status of PAHs in soil,surface soil samples from background areas,rural areas,and urban areas in China were collected,and 16 PAHs were measured using GC-MS to analyze the content,pollution characteristics,and ecological risks of PAHs in soil from different regions.The results showed that the PAHs in the background area were found to be less or very low in content,and were almost not contaminated by polycyclic aromatic hydrocarbons.Due to the impact of industrial enterprises'production activities,transportation,wastewater,exhaust gas,and solid waste emissions in urban areas,the content of PAHs in soil is high,resulting in serious pollution.The proportion of seven carcinogenic polycyclic aromatic hydrocarbons is high,with a high toxic equivalent concentration,and a high risk of carcinogenesis.Soil polycyclic aromatic hydrocarbons in rural areas are slightly polluted,with a low pollution risk.
